Product Overview

Category

The SMAJ10AHE3/61 belongs to the category of electronic components, specifically a transient voltage suppressor diode.

Use

It is used to protect sensitive electronic devices from voltage spikes and transients.

Characteristics

  • Low leakage current
  • Fast response time
  • High surge capability

Package

The SMAJ10AHE3/61 is typically available in a DO-214AC (SMA) package.

Essence

The essence of this product lies in its ability to divert excessive voltage away from sensitive components, thereby safeguarding them from damage.

Packaging/Quantity

It is commonly packaged in reels or trays, with quantities varying based on manufacturer specifications.

Specifications

  • Peak Pulse Power: 400W
  • Breakdown Voltage Range: 9.4V to 10.5V
  • Maximum Clamping Voltage: 15.6V
  • Operating Temperature Range: -55°C to 150°C

Detailed Pin Configuration

The SMAJ10AHE3/61 typically has two pins, with the anode connected to the positive side and the cathode connected to the negative side of the circuit.

Functional Features

  • Transient voltage suppression
  • Reverse standoff voltage protection
  • Fast response to voltage spikes

Advantages and Disadvantages

Advantages

  • Effective protection against voltage transients
  • Fast response time
  • Compact size

Disadvantages

  • Limited power dissipation capability
  • May require additional circuitry for comprehensive protection

Working Principles

The SMAJ10AHE3/61 operates by diverting excess voltage away from sensitive components when a transient voltage spike occurs. It acts as a shunt to redirect the excessive energy to ground, protecting the downstream circuitry.

Detailed Application Field Plans

This diode is commonly used in various electronic applications, including: - Power supplies - Communication equipment - Automotive electronics - Industrial control systems

Detailed and Complete Alternative Models

Some alternative models to the SMAJ10AHE3/61 include: - P6KE10A - 1.5KE10A - SMBJ10A

In conclusion, the SMAJ10AHE3/61 transient voltage suppressor diode provides essential protection for sensitive electronic devices, offering fast response and high surge capability. While it has limitations in power dissipation, its compact size and effectiveness make it a valuable component in various electronic applications.

  1. What is the SMAJ10AHE3/61?

    • The SMAJ10AHE3/61 is a surface mount transient voltage suppressor diode designed to protect sensitive electronic components from voltage spikes and transients.
  2. What is the maximum peak pulse power of the SMAJ10AHE3/61?

    • The maximum peak pulse power of the SMAJ10AHE3/61 is 400 watts.
  3. What is the breakdown voltage of the SMAJ10AHE3/61?

    • The breakdown voltage of the SMAJ10AHE3/61 is 10 volts.
  4. In what type of technical solutions can the SMAJ10AHE3/61 be used?

    • The SMAJ10AHE3/61 can be used in various technical solutions such as power supplies, telecommunications equipment, automotive electronics, and industrial control systems.
  5. What is the operating temperature range of the SMAJ10AHE3/61?

    • The operating temperature range of the SMAJ10AHE3/61 is -55°C to 150°C.
  6. Does the SMAJ10AHE3/61 comply with any industry standards?

    • Yes, the SMAJ10AHE3/61 complies with the industry standard JEDEC registered package outline DO-214AC.
  7. What are the key features of the SMAJ10AHE3/61?

    • The key features of the SMAJ10AHE3/61 include low profile, excellent clamping capability, fast response time, and high surge current capability.
  8. Can the SMAJ10AHE3/61 be used for ESD protection?

    • Yes, the SMAJ10AHE3/61 can be used for electrostatic discharge (ESD) protection in various electronic circuits and systems.
  9. What are the typical applications of the SMAJ10AHE3/61?

    • The typical applications of the SMAJ10AHE3/61 include protection of voltage-sensitive devices, overvoltage protection in consumer electronics, and surge suppression in data lines.
  10. Is the SMAJ10AHE3/61 RoHS compliant?

    • Yes, the SMAJ10AHE3/61 is RoHS compliant, meaning it meets the Restriction of Hazardous Substances directive for environmental safety.
